SB856: Mass transit; establishing various Funds to improve transportation.

This vote on SB856 was held in the Senate. The vote was on this subject: “Reconsideration of conference report agreed to by Senate”. This vote passed 40-0.

Explanation

At left is the tally of who voted how on this bill.

It’s important to understand that most bills are voted on multiple times, and the vote is not necessarily simply whether or not the bill should pass. Be sure to look at the bill’s history to determine what, exactly, was being voted on, and at what point in the bill’s progress.
